Dislodge and Enroot

Dislodge

Dislodge verb - Remove or force from a position of dwelling previously occupied.

Enroot

Enroot verb - To set solidly in or as if in surrounding matter.
Usage example: a deeply enrooted tradition of respect for the elderly

Dislodge is an antonym for enroot.
